About the Geneva Business School
The Geneva School of Business was founded in 2001 with the goal of providing quality business education at an international level. The school focuses on the relevant skills necessary for success in the global economy. The institution's educational philosophy is aimed at developing critical thinking, innovation, and the practical application of knowledge through unique teaching methods, including case studies, group projects, and hands-on internships. The Geneva School of Business has a good reputation due to its international education standards and successful graduates who occupy leading positions in various industries. The school actively collaborates with international companies and organizations, which enhances the practical training of students. The main objectives of the institution include developing leadership qualities, a global perspective, and entrepreneurial competencies among students, preparing them for successful careers in business.

Admission conditions in Geneva Business School
To apply to the Geneva School of Business, candidates must go through an application process that includes academic ranking, the possibility of an interview, and an evaluation of motivation. Mandatory exams: IELTS or TOEFL to confirm language proficiency. Minimum age: 18 years. Application process: Applications are submitted online through the official website, with a fee of approximately 200 euros. Educational qualifications: High school diploma or its equivalent. Required documents: Application, CV, letters of recommendation, and test results. Requirements for international students: Minimum level of English proficiency confirmed by exams. Financial conditions: Proof of funds for study and living expenses is required. Application deadlines: Dates depend on the program, usually from January to June. Testing or interview: An interview may be conducted if necessary. Qualifications or experience: Work experience is encouraged but not mandatory. Notification of results: Results will be communicated via email within 2-3 weeks after the application is submitted.
MoreMinimum rating for admission to Geneva Business School
The minimum score for admission is 6.0 IELTS or 80 TOEFL.
